Blood Orange and Raspberry Sparkler

Prep Time20 minutes mins
Cook Time5 minutes mins
Total Time25 minutes mins
Course: Cocktail
Servings: 3
Author: Simply Happenstance

Ingredients

  • 1 cup San Pellegrino Aranciata Rossa
  • 1/2 cup sparkling lime water
  • 2 tablespoons raspberry simple syrup recipe below
  • 1 ounce St. Germain
  • 1 1/2 ounce Vodka
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up raspberries frozen or fresh
  • lime
  • mint
  • ice
  • water

Instructions

  • In a small sauce pan add two cups water to one cup sugar.
  • Bring to a boil and then switch to medium love heat.
  • Add the raspberries.
  • Once sugar is fully dissolved, remove from heat and let cool.
  • Next add sparkling water, pellegrino, simple syrup, St. Germain, and Vodka to a chilled martini shaker.
  • Shake lightly.
  • Pour into 2-3 glasses and garnish with a squeeze of lime, ice, and a mint sprig.

Simple Sangria Recipe

August 26, 2014

This Simple Sangria Recipe really is that simple.  Perfect for end of summer parties and great for Game Day!:: Simple Sangria Recipe ::

This Simple Sangria Recipe has a fun story.  In September I will be celebrating my 11th wedding anniversary! My hubby and I got married at a winery.  We both love and enjoy wine. I learned how to make this Simple Sangria Recipe after we had a tasting at the winery in which we wed.  They had a band playing on a warm Sunday afternoon and large vats of Sangria on hand for those customers tasting wine.  It was delicious and it seemed fairly easy to make from what the wine employees had said. {Mind you I wrote down what I thought went in this Sangria on a napkin}.  A little of this and a little of that and a bunch of fruit that sits over night.  The perfect Sangria for Game Days when you are celebrating a good win with friends.
